public void testSimpleBind() throws Exception {
String testcol = this.root + "testSimpleBind/";
String subcol1 = testcol + "bindtest1/";
String testres1 = subcol1 + "res1";
String subcol2 = testcol + "bindtest2/";
String testres2 = subcol2 + "res2";
int status;
try {
MkColMethod mkcol = new MkColMethod(testcol);
status = this.client.executeMethod(mkcol);
assertEquals(201, status);
mkcol = new MkColMethod(subcol1);
status = this.client.executeMethod(mkcol);
assertEquals(201, status);
mkcol = new MkColMethod(subcol2);
status = this.client.executeMethod(mkcol);
assertEquals(201, status);
//create new resource R with path bindtest1/res1
PutMethod put = new PutMethod(testres1);
put.setRequestEntity(new StringRequestEntity("foo", "text/plain", "UTF-8"));
status = this.client.executeMethod(put);
assertEquals(201, status);
//create new binding of R with path bindtest2/res2
DavMethodBase bind = new BindMethod(subcol2, new BindInfo(testres1, "res2"));
status = this.client.executeMethod(bind);
assertEquals(201, status);
//check if both bindings report the same DAV:resource-id
assertEquals(this.getResourceId(testres1), this.getResourceId(testres2));
//compare representations retrieved with both paths
GetMethod get = new GetMethod(testres1);
status = this.client.executeMethod(get);
assertEquals(200, status);
assertEquals("foo", get.getResponseBodyAsString());
get = new GetMethod(testres2);
status = this.client.executeMethod(get);
assertEquals(200, status);
assertEquals("foo", get.getResponseBodyAsString());
//modify R using the new path
put = new PutMethod(testres2);
put.setRequestEntity(new StringRequestEntity("bar", "text/plain", "UTF-8"));
status = this.client.executeMethod(put);
assertTrue("status: " + status, status == 200 || status == 204);
//compare representations retrieved with both paths
get = new GetMethod(testres1);
status = this.client.executeMethod(get);
assertEquals(200, status);
assertEquals("bar", get.getResponseBodyAsString());
get = new GetMethod(testres2);
status = this.client.executeMethod(get);
assertEquals(200, status);
assertEquals("bar", get.getResponseBodyAsString());
} finally {
DeleteMethod delete = new DeleteMethod(testcol);
status = this.client.executeMethod(delete);
assertTrue("status: " + status, status == 200 || status == 204);
}
}

public void testBindOverwrite() throws Exception {
String testcol = this.root + "testSimpleBind/";
String subcol1 = testcol + "bindtest1/";
String testres1 = subcol1 + "res1";
String subcol2 = testcol + "bindtest2/";
String testres2 = subcol2 + "res2";
int status;
try {
MkColMethod mkcol = new MkColMethod(testcol);
status = this.client.executeMethod(mkcol);
assertEquals(201, status);
mkcol = new MkColMethod(subcol1);
status = this.client.executeMethod(mkcol);
assertEquals(201, status);
mkcol = new MkColMethod(subcol2);
status = this.client.executeMethod(mkcol);
assertEquals(201, status);
//create new resource R with path bindtest1/res1
PutMethod put = new PutMethod(testres1);
put.setRequestEntity(new StringRequestEntity("foo", "text/plain", "UTF-8"));
status = this.client.executeMethod(put);
assertEquals(201, status);
//create new resource R' with path bindtest2/res2
put = new PutMethod(testres2);
put.setRequestEntity(new StringRequestEntity("bar", "text/plain", "UTF-8"));
status = this.client.executeMethod(put);
assertEquals(201, status);
//try to create new binding of R with path bindtest2/res2 and Overwrite:F
DavMethodBase bind = new BindMethod(subcol2, new BindInfo(testres1, "res2"));
bind.addRequestHeader(new Header("Overwrite", "F"));
status = this.client.executeMethod(bind);
assertEquals(412, status);
//verify that bindtest2/res2 still points to R'
GetMethod get = new GetMethod(testres2);
status = this.client.executeMethod(get);
assertEquals(200, status);
assertEquals("bar", get.getResponseBodyAsString());
//create new binding of R with path bindtest2/res2
bind = new BindMethod(subcol2, new BindInfo(testres1, "res2"));
status = this.client.executeMethod(bind);
assertTrue("status: " + status, status == 200 || status == 204);
//verify that bindtest2/res2 now points to R
get = new GetMethod(testres2);
status = this.client.executeMethod(get);
assertEquals(200, status);
assertEquals("foo", get.getResponseBodyAsString());
//verify that the initial binding is still there
HeadMethod head = new HeadMethod(testres1);
status = this.client.executeMethod(head);
assertEquals(200, status);
} finally {
DeleteMethod delete = new DeleteMethod(testcol);
status = this.client.executeMethod(delete);
assertTrue("status: " + status, status == 200 || status == 204);
}
}
